The rubber peptizers market plays a crucial role in the rubber industry by improving the processing and molding properties of rubber compounds. These chemical additives are vital for enhancing the plasticity and processability of rubber, which significantly improves the efficiency of manufacturing processes. Rubber peptizers help in breaking down the rubber’s structure, making it more flexible, facilitating better flow, and allowing for easier mixing and processing. This market is increasingly benefiting from advancements in the automotive and industrial sectors, where high-performance rubber products are in demand. With technological innovations, the demand for specialized rubber peptizers has surged, contributing to market growth.

By Type:

  • Dibenzamido Diphenyl Disulphide (DBD):Dibenzamido diphenyl disulphide (DBD) is one of the most commonly used rubber peptizers in the market due to its ability to improve the processing properties of rubber. DBD is widely employed in the automotive industry for manufacturing tires, seals, and other components that require high durability. The compound facilitates the breakdown of rubber's molecular structure, allowing for better flow and easier processing, which ultimately results in higher quality products. The growing automotive and manufacturing sectors contribute significantly to the increased demand for DBD-based peptizers, especially in regions like North America and Asia.

  • Pentachlorothiophenol:Pentachlorothiophenol is another important type of rubber peptizer, used primarily for its excellent properties in enhancing the processing and durability of rubber. It is most commonly used in the production of rubber for electrical insulation, medical devices, and high-performance automotive parts. The demand for pentachlorothiophenol is increasing as industries seek higher efficiency in rubber processing and improved final product performance. This type of peptizer is preferred in applications that require resistance to heat and chemicals, which are critical in industries like electronics and automotive manufacturing.

  • Zinc Pentachlorothiophenate:Zinc pentachlorothiophenate is a highly effective peptizer for rubber that is used to improve the processing characteristics, particularly in rubber compounds used in high-temperature environments. It is most commonly applied in the automotive industry, particularly in the production of tires and other components exposed to extreme conditions. Zinc pentachlorothiophenate allows rubber to maintain its flexibility and durability even under stress, making it ideal for heavy-duty applications. The increasing demand for more durable and heat-resistant rubber products, particularly in automotive and industrial applications, is driving the demand for this peptizer.

  • Aryl Mercaptans:Aryl mercaptans are a class of rubber peptizers that are widely used for their excellent vulcanization properties. They play a significant role in the rubber industry by enhancing the processing properties of both natural and synthetic rubbers. Aryl mercaptans are especially useful in improving the processing of rubber compounds for manufacturing automotive tires, footwear, and industrial components. Their effectiveness in reducing the viscosity of rubber while maintaining its mechanical properties makes them highly sought after in industries requiring high-quality rubber products. The growing demand for such rubber products in the automotive and consumer goods sectors supports the continued demand for aryl mercaptans.

  • Mercaptobenzothiazole:Mercaptobenzothiazole is one of the most widely used rubber peptizers, known for its excellent compatibility with both natural and synthetic rubbers. It is typically used in the production of tires, automotive parts, and industrial rubber goods. This peptizer is valued for its ability to enhance the plasticity of rubber, which improves the ease of processing. With the continued growth in industries like automotive, construction, and medical devices, the demand for mercaptobenzothiazole is expected to remain strong. Its effectiveness in improving the processing and performance of rubber products has made it a staple in the rubber manufacturing industry.

  • Others:In addition to the primary types of rubber peptizers mentioned, there are several other types that cater to specific industrial needs. These include various formulations and blends that combine multiple chemicals to enhance the efficiency of rubber processing. Such peptizers are used in niche applications that require specialized rubber characteristics, such as high resilience or resistance to wear and tear. The "Others" segment in the rubber peptizers market includes emerging alternatives that may combine both natural and synthetic ingredients to meet sustainability demands while improving processing times and product durability.

By Application:

  • Natural Rubber:Natural rubber remains one of the dominant applications for rubber peptizers due to its widespread use in products like tires, footwear, and medical devices. Natural rubber is prized for its flexibility, resilience, and high tensile strength, making it an ideal choice for demanding applications. The demand for natural rubber-based products has been consistently rising, driven by industries that require high-quality and durable materials. As natural rubber production increases in regions such as Southeast Asia, the demand for peptizers that optimize the processing of natural rubber continues to grow, especially in applications like automotive and healthcare.

  • Synthetic Rubber:Synthetic rubber is another major application in the rubber peptizers market, used extensively in the automotive and industrial sectors. It offers a broader range of properties, such as greater heat and wear resistance, making it ideal for products like tires, hoses, and seals. The demand for synthetic rubber is driven by the increasing automotive production and the growing need for high-performance rubber products. With advancements in synthetic rubber formulations, the demand for peptizers to enhance the processing and efficiency of synthetic rubber compounds is expected to rise, especially in emerging markets and industries focused on sustainable production methods.
